Isaac Impacts?
The remnants of Isaac will move over Missouri then move across IL/IN/OH as a weak cold front picks the remnant system up. In far Western KY from along and west of US 45, and right along the Ohio River 1-3 inches of rain is possible. Locally more if heavier bands form, and localized flooding may occur under these heavier bands if they from. Elsewhere in Western KY and into Middle TN .75 to just under 2 inches of rain is in the forecast. Wind gusts of 30-35mph may cause issues on area lakes for a part of Labor Day Weekend. The heaviest rain chances are for Friday and Saturday.

Drought
Portions of Union, Henderson, McCracken, and Ballard County have been upgraded to D4(exceptional drought). This is often the sign of a historical drought developing. These areas have also dodged a lot of the heavy rain the past week. Paducah KY has picked up 2.82 inches of rain since April 1st. They average 15.55 inches during that timeframe.
